Key issues (materiality)
The world faces many serious issues, including climate change problems and rising populations. Companies play prominent roles in solving those issues. At the Nihon Parkerizing Group, we have identified six key issues (materiality) that we must address by identifying risks and opportunities in our business activities under Vision2030, our management vision that we announced in May 2021. We will create new value by proactively addressing social issues as a specialist in surface modification to be a company that continues developing and growing together with society.
Process of identifying key issues (materiality)
Step 1 Understanding social issues
- Identifying social issues regarding international standards and frameworks (SDGs, ISO 26000, GRI Standards) and evaluation items of ESG evaluation organizations
- Considering their relevance to our business and industry-specific content
Step 2 Identifying issues and evaluating their significance
- Organizing and focusing the management issues that were examined and extracted in terms of two axes: their importance for stakeholders and their importance for us
- Evaluating them from the viewpoints of "creating social value through business" and "meeting the requirements of society", respectively
Step 3 Identifying materiality
- Receiving approval by the Board of Directors following a dialogue with experts and deliberation by management
- Identifying six key issues (materiality) as priority issues
Key Issues (Materiality)
1. Creating a more affluent society through surface modification technologies
Developing new products and technology that are environmentally friendly
We contribute to preserving the global environment by reducing the environmental impact of our customers' manufacturing processes by developing new products and technologies, such as diverse chemicals, that meet the demands of EVs and lighter vehicles. These chemicals do not contain hazardous chemicals, equipment that reduces environmental impact, and low-temperature treatment technologies.
Developing new fields, making the most of surface modification technologies
As surface modification specialists, we will utilize our technological capabilities to develop business areas in non-metallic, multifunctional, and new markets and contribute to solving a wide range of social issues.
Promoting open innovation
We are committed to creating new value by actively promoting collaboration with various companies and research institutions, academia, and government in Japan and overseas, developing technologies from new perspectives, and creating new value.
